I've done it this way, mainly using these 5 methods:

1. I've mainly concentrated on 'how-to' manuals.
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
This is the equivalent of Warren Buffet's stock market
success in industrial stocks, and his choosing large,
secure, uninteresting business to invest in - those like
Coca-Cola and newspapers. My choice of 'how-to'
books are the solid, secure foundations of the writing
market. Children's books (is there a Harry Potter in you?)
come and go, popular fiction is almost impossible to
succeed in, but technical manuals that show others
how to complete a task will always be in demand.
Steady and sure income. Boring even.

2. I've written 4 manuals, one of over 400 pages.
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
The first two covered areas of uncontrolled investment
(yes - gambling!) and money management, that helped
others improve their circumstances. These were written
to assist others, and as a result I had only 6 returns for
the many thousands I sold over the years. How-to
books are winners!

3. I used previous successes to build my enterprise.
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^

The third manual: "How To Make $100,000 A Year Part-
Time Creating Your Own How-To Manuals At Home" was
a book on how others could succeed in the same way I
had previously. I showed everything I knew and wrote from
practical experience. This manual sold well by mail, and
then a couple of years later I started selling on the net.
The result from those also-successful years was the best-
selling "eBook Secrets: How To Create & Sell Your Own
Profitable eBook Using Free & Nearly-Free Programs."
Can you see how I wrote about real-world success as I
achieved it? This was, and is, a winning strategy.

4. I built a list that I sold to again and again.
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
I kept all the names and addresses of all my purchasers.
This created a list - currently scattered about over several
computers and mailing list systems that one day I will
bring together - that had confidence in me. I sold to this
willing list over and over again, in various ways.

5. I developed more products and services.
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
This is probably the most important part of my enterprise
story. You can't make a living on one product unless
you're very clever (and I'm not). You need many income
streams. And your enterprise becomes more powerful
because your prospects now perceive you as a fully-
fledged business instead of a one off, possible fly-by-
nighter. More products on offer shows you take your
business seriously.
